Man convicted of stabbing B.C. teen to death claims 'demon' voices told him to 'kill, kill, kill'


Supreme Court hearing which will determine whether he should be held not criminally responsible for his actions because of a mental disorder. "A voice in my head was going 'kill, kill, kill' … It happened so quickly that I feel like the voice in my head was in control, and I wasn't." But a judge has to decide if he should be held criminally responsible. Gabriel Klein, captured on surveillance video in November 2016, hours before stabbing two female students at a high school in Abbotsford, B.C. Dr. Samantha Saffy claimed Klein told her he planned to argue that he was not criminally responsible.
